As the Senior Planner your responsibilities will include but are not limited to:
- Developing and managing detailed construction programmes across multiple projects
- Supporting pre-construction and bid teams with tender planning activities
- Monitoring project progress and identifying risks or programme delays
- Producing programme updates and reports for key stakeholders
- Working closely with project managers, site teams, and subcontractors
- Contributing to planning best practice and continuous improvement initiatives
The successful applicant will be able to demonstrate:
- Previous experience in a Senior Planner or Planning role within the construction sector
- Strong understanding of construction methodologies and project sequencing
- Proficiency using planning software such as Asta Powerproject or Primavera P6
-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ills
- A proactive and organised approach with strong problem-solving ability
